Output 57aa4f4e6ea1788d86a3e4cf1fc3a219f53034a5edeaac301ad8a951aa599f4d:1

value
4017662107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bca705b62577128e9d1105c950528616f2cb04a OP_EQUAL
address
MLeJfo6cVUSnFBpeQo8am2tXrm6UwFfrih
transaction
57aa4f4e6ea1788d86a3e4cf1fc3a219f53034a5edeaac301ad8a951aa599f4d
spent
true